NWSA Guide to Graduate Work in Women's and Gender Studies Olivia C. Smith, Editor. This thoughtful selection of essays includes advice from graduate chairs and from students themselves on topics ranging from finding the right program fit to applying women's studies outside of the classroom. It also examines practical issues like how to incorporate women's studies into traditional disciplinary graduate study and combining motherhood and graduate work.
